QuickFit 26 is the larger of Garmin's two QuickFit clip sizes, built for the biggest Garmin cases. A rotating cam connector clips onto the watch's bar and releases with a flip of a small lever — no spring-bar tool required.
This size covers Garmin's largest, most rugged watches, listed by family below.
Like QuickFit 22, this is a Garmin-specific clip system rather than a universal spring-bar fitting — see our quick release watch straps if you're after standard-width straps for a non-Garmin or non-QuickFit watch instead.
If you're not sure whether your Garmin watch uses QuickFit at all, check the underside of your current strap for a small lever near the case — QuickFit connectors have one built into the strap itself, while standard spring-bar straps hide their lever inside the bar between the lugs instead. Garmin also states the connector type directly in each watch's owner's manual and product spec page, which is worth checking if the strap on your wrist doesn't make it obvious.

QuickFit 26 exists because Garmin's largest watches — built for diving, tactical use, ultra-endurance racing and aviation — carry bigger batteries and more sensors, which means bigger cases and a proportionally wider strap. Rather than stretch a single QuickFit size across every case, Garmin split the system in two so the connector geometry matches the case properly at both ends of its range.

Flip out the small lever on the underside of the connector to rotate the cam open and lift the strap off the bar. To fit a new strap, hook the open connector onto the bar and rotate the lever closed until it sits flat.
As with QuickFit 22, the single-clip design generally makes size-26 swaps faster than a standard spring-bar strap, since there's no pin to compress into a lug gap.
It's worth practicing the motion once on a watch you're not wearing, since the cam mechanism moves a little differently from a spring bar the first few times you use it.
Hand-wash with mild soap and water and lay flat to dry. Avoid machine washing or wringing, which can stretch the nylon weave and stress the QuickFit connector over time.
Letting it dry fully before wearing it again also helps avoid trapping moisture against the QuickFit connector's moving parts.
